- Title
- Southeastern Livestock Exposition Rodeo, commended
- Summary
The Alabama House passed a resolution commending the Southeastern Livestock Exposition Rodeo for its positive impact on the state and thanking those who organize it.
What This Bill DoesIt recognizes the SLE Rodeo as a longstanding Alabama event that supports the livestock industry, youth leadership, charities, and education. It notes a 2010 format change with the IPRA All-Region National Finals being hosted in Montgomery. It acknowledges the rodeo's social and economic impact on Alabama communities, especially Talladega and Montgomery Counties, and expresses gratitude to the people who work to make the event successful each year.
Who It Affects- Southeastern Livestock Exposition Rodeo organizers, staff, volunteers, and participants who are publicly commended and thanked.
- Alabama youth and charitable/educational organizations that benefit from the rodeo's support and leadership opportunities.
- Local communities in Alabama, particularly Talladega County and Montgomery County, that experience economic and social impact from the event.
